Qingdao Jiaodong International Airport
Qingdao's modern gateway replacing the former Liuting Airport.
- ›Opened on August 12, 2021, replacing Qingdao Liuting International Airport after nearly four decades of operation.
- ›Located in Jiaozhou, approximately 39 kilometers from downtown Qingdao.
- ›Designed with an annual capacity of around 35 million passengers in its initial phase.
- ›The airport incorporates high-speed rail access, connecting it to the national rail network.
- ›Qingdao is known as the home of Tsingtao Beer and hosts significant trade and tourism traffic.

Qingdao Jiaodong International Airport is an international airport serving the city of Qingdao in East China's Shandong province. It received approval in December 2013, and replaced Qingdao Liuting International Airport as the city's main airport in 2021. It is located in Jiaodong, Jiaozhou, approximately 39 kilometres (24 mi) from Qingdao city centre. The airport opened on 12 August 2021 and is currently the largest airport in Shandong, capable of handling 35 million passengers annually.
